Bagikan melalui


PropertyGridEditorPart.ApplyChanges Metode

Definisi

Menyimpan nilai dari PropertyGridEditorPart kontrol ke properti terkait dalam kontrol terkait WebPart .

public:
 override bool ApplyChanges();
public override bool ApplyChanges ();
override this.ApplyChanges : unit -> bool
Public Overrides Function ApplyChanges () As Boolean

Mengembalikan

true jika tindakan menyimpan nilai dari ke PropertyGridEditorPartWebPart berhasil; jika tidak (jika terjadi kesalahan), false.

Pengecualian

Terjadi kesalahan saat mencoba mengatur nilai untuk properti pada yang terkait WebPart.

Keterangan

Metode ApplyChanges ini adalah metode penting pada PropertyGridEditorPart kontrol. Metode menyimpan nilai yang telah ditetapkan pengguna pada PropertyGridEditorPart kontrol ke properti terkait dalam kontrol terkait WebPart . Kontrol terkait direferensikan dalam PropertyGridEditorPart properti yang diwariskan WebPartToEdit kontrol.

Penting

Anda tidak dapat mengambil ApplyChanges alih metode karena PropertyGridEditorPart jenis disegel untuk mencegah pewarisannya. Namun, jika Anda membutuhkan kontrol yang lebih terprogram atas proses pengeditan berbagai WebPart properti kontrol daripada PropertyGridEditorPart yang disediakan kontrol, Anda dapat membuat kontrol kustom EditorPart dan menyediakan implementasi Anda sendiri dari metode ini. Untuk contoh kode, lihat ApplyChanges metode .

Metode ini ApplyChanges mencoba mengatur nilai pada properti kustom publik dalam kontrol terkait WebPart , asalkan properti tersebut masing-masing memiliki [WebBrowsable(true)] atribut .

Metode ApplyChanges ini dipanggil ketika pengguna mengklik tombol yang mewakili OK atau kata kerja terapkan di antarmuka pengguna pengeditan (UI). Anda juga dapat memanggilnya langsung dari kode Anda sendiri jika ada kebutuhan untuk menyimpan nilai yang diedit selain dari tindakan pengguna.

Berlaku untuk

Lihat juga